Giancarlo Stanton cleared waivers on Sunday, according to multiple sources, meaning that the Miami Marlins can trade him to any team through the end of August.

Stanton is baseball's hottest hitter and clubbed his 44th home run on Tuesday night. He has 10 years and $295 million remaining on his contract.

According to sources, at least four teams have inquired about Stanton and in some negotiations names have been discussed.
